Re: Where to get bearing locally
You're looking for a standard flanged R6 bearing. Any industrial supply store that carries bearings should have them; if you can survive without a flanged bearing, it should be easier still to find them.

Re: Where to get bearing locally
Motion Industries does carry them. FR6-ZZ is flanged double shielded.
